Xining Travel Tips

Xining is the capital city of Northwest China’s Qinghai province where there is large population of Muslims. Historically, Xining has been one of the most important cities on the Silk Road and Muslims have been inhabited in Xining since ancient times. Tour Itinerary Planning

Xining is located on Qinghai-Tibet Plateau. The best time to travel around Xining is from June to the end of September. The rest of year can be very cold in Xining. When planning your Xining tour, two days will be perfect, you can arrange your first day in Xining visiting Qinghai Lake which is about 151 km away from Xining. Qinghai Lake is the largest salt water lake in China covering a area of 4186 square kilometers. On the second day, you may visit the Kumbum Monastery which is birth place of Tsongkhapa, the founder of the Gelugpa (Yellow Hat) sect of Tibetan Buddhism and the Qinghai Dongguan Mosque, one of the largest mosques in Northwest China.

Halal Restaurants in Xining

Xining is one of the cities in China where you can easily find Halal restaurants. You can find Beef Noodles restaurants almost in every corner of Xining.

Mosques in Xining

There are 239 mosques in Xining and its suburban area. Xining’s Muslim community is at Dongguan area with the Dongguan Mosque as the center. Xining Dongguan Mosque is the largest well-preserved mosque in Xining, capital city of Qinghai province. Xining Dongguan Mosque also ranks as one of the four most famous mosques in Northwest China. Xining Dongguan Mosque was built in the Song Dynasty (907-1379) with a history of 900 years. It has undergone several destructions and reconstructions since then. The existing buildings were rebuilt in 1913, expanded in 1946, and renovated in 1979. Xining Dongguan mosque covers an area of 13,602 square meters now, and the construction area is 4,654 square meters. Dongguan mosque combines the traditional Chinese architectural art with the Islamic architectural form.

Money Exchange

You can exchange traveler's checks or cash at most banks, and most 5-star and 4-star hotels always have a money exchange counter. You can also get a cash advance on your credit card on ATM machine. The exchange rate all over China are the same fixed by Bank of China. To change money, you have to have your passport at hand. If you want to change money in a hotel, you usually have to be a guest there. Sometimes if you are not a guest in a hotel but need to change money there, you can just say a random room number, but this doesn't always work. Remember to keep the exchange slip well because you need this slip to change the Chinese Yuan back to your currency if you do have this need at the end of the tour. At present, the RMB is not exchangeable on the International market, so it is only usable within the country. So when you are changing money, don't change too much, because it is difficult to change back into other currencies. To change RMB back into your home currency, you must retain the exchange slips that are given to you at the bank or money exchange counter.
